SMITE 2 OB13 Hotfix Tackles Mercury Bugs and More

July 3 hotfix addresses crashes, Mercury glitches, and map lighting issues in SMITE 2.

SMITE 2 players woke up to a fresh hotfix on July 3, eager to smooth out some rough edges from the OB13 update. The patch fixes several crashes and a slew of Mercury-related bugs that were causing headaches in matches. Plus, it spruces up the Assault map’s lighting and adds sound effects to the new queue screen.

Mercury mains might breathe easier now, the patch tackles multiple issues with his abilities. His Maximum Velocity (2) no longer causes desync problems, root immunity, or breaks his attack animations. His Special Delivery (3) is also fixed to properly grant knockup immunity and avoid trapping him in a spinning animation. Even Mercury’s passive, which was accidentally buffing empowered basic attacks, got toned down.

Besides Mercury’s whirlwind of fixes, some quirky minion “moonwalking” behavior has been corrected, and the Joust Teleporter will be available from the start of matches instead of being disabled for 10 minutes. The Assault map’s odd blue lighting, which previously threw off the vibe in some areas, has been adjusted. Also, players using Action Cam won’t see oversized global emotes anymore, and Xbox users will finally see their mouse cursor again.

OB13 July 3 Hotfix Patch Notes

  • Fixed several crash cases
  • Fixed an issue where the Joust Teleporter was disabled for the first 10 minutes of a match
  • Fixed an issue on the Assault map where there were large areas with unintentional blue lighting
  • Added Sound FX to the new Queue Screen
  • Fixed an issue where Mercury’s basic Attacks could get desynced when using Maximum Velocity (2) mid attack chain
  • Fixed an issue where sometimes minions would “moonwalk” and behave in an unintended way
  • Adjusted Combat Dodge in Quickplay to better match jump animations
  • Fixed an issue where Mercury’s Maximum Velocity (2) was making him root immune
  • Fixed an issue where Mercury’s Special Delivery (3) was not knockup immune
  • Fixed an issue where Mercury could get stuck in a “spinning” animation state after using Special Delivery (3)
  • Fixed an issue where Mercury’s Passive was buffing the Strength contribution to his empowered Basic Attack
  • Fixed an issue where Global Emotes were appearing too large for players using Action Cam
  • Fixed an issue where Awilix could no longer summon Suku if she died to Mercury’s Special Delivery (3) while on Suku
  • Fixed an issue where the Mouse cursor was not showing up on Xbox
